Chapter 96 - First Acknowledgment

Silence lingered over the training court.

Moments earlier, laughter had filled the arena when Master Oren Veyr's Lightning Palm had hurled Hawk several paces across the stone floor.

Now, not a soul laughed.

Hawk stood where he had stopped, one hand brushing the dust from his sleeve. The warmth had vanished from his scarred face.

His expression settled into something quieter, sharper, like a wolf that had stopped playing.

Master Oren noticed it immediately. The old master's fingers curled slightly.

He had crossed hands with countless martial artists over four decades.

A single exchange often revealed more than an hour of conversation.

The man before him had intentionally accepted the first strike.

Not because he could not avoid it, because he wished to understand it.

Oren's heartbeat quickened.

"So," he murmured, lowering into his stance once more. "Shall we begin for real?"

Hawk inclined his head. "I've learned enough to answer now."

The old master smiled. "So have I."
